Transaction f6662e269dccf2b2018cc7bf4fefc0cd23d7079ce1503f30cd551b9af08eaab4

3 Input
2 Outputs
  • f6662e269dccf2b2018cc7bf4fefc0cd23d7079ce1503f30cd551b9af08eaab4:0
  • value  32677840
    address  15BuqTBypuXEe85G7i837A1nY11fAizi1U
  • f6662e269dccf2b2018cc7bf4fefc0cd23d7079ce1503f30cd551b9af08eaab4:1
  • value  5402740
    address  3BMEXK7begWkKChXjsbQAQXZKnoxCAwQ9b